Sterling professor
nounEtymology
Named after John William Sterling (1844–1918), partner in the New York law firm Shearman & Sterling and an 1864 graduate of Yale College, who funded such professorships with a $15-million bequest.
Definitions
A professor with the highest academic title at Yale University.
